Enchiladas are a classic Mexican dish made from corn or flour tortillas, filled with a savory mixture, then covered in a chili-infused sauce and baked with cheese. This recipe features a chicken version, guaranteed to delight your taste buds with juicy chicken, spicy sauce, and melted cheese. Steps
Prepare Chicken Filling
Preheat a skillet over medium heat with olive oil. Add the chopped onion and sauté for 3-5 minutes until softened. Add the minced garlic, chili powder, ground cumin, salt, and pepper, and cook for another 1 minute until fragrant. Add the chicken breast, cook until fully done, then shred it with a fork or cut into small pieces. Mix with the seasoned onion base.
Assemble Enchiladas
Preheat your oven to 190°C (375°F). Pour a thin layer of enchilada sauce into the bottom of a 9x13 inch (23x33 cm) baking dish. Dip each tortilla individually into the sauce (or warm them in the microwave for 15-20 seconds to make them more pliable). Place a portion of the chicken filling and a sprinkle of shredded cheese in the center of each tortilla, then roll it up tightly. Place the rolled tortillas seam-side down in the baking dish.
Bake and Serve
Pour the remaining enchilada sauce over the rolled tortillas, then sprinkle with the remaining shredded cheese. Bake in the preheated oven for 20-25 minutes, or until the cheese is melted and bubbly and the edges are slightly crispy. Remove from the oven, let rest for 5 minutes, then garnish with fresh cilantro (if using). Serve with sour cream or Greek yogurt, if desired.
Extra Tips
► You can cook or bake the chicken in advance to speed up preparation.
► If you like it spicy, add some finely chopped jalapeño to the filling.
► Serve with fresh avocado slices or guacamole for an even more complete experience.
